Australian church investigates clerical abuse connections
The Australian Catholic Church is investigating whether any clerical abusers in Ireland had connections with its ministries.
It follows the publication of the Ryan report last year, which revealed a 60-year period of extensive sexual and physical abuse of children by priests, nuns and lay staff within the Irish Catholic Church.
